The below YouYube clip about Venezuela is very telling and very profound. It is profound because it is from a video like this where a viewer can get a sense of truth about today's dog-eat-dog world of politics. It is telling because it is the truth!

Most folks think of comedian John Oliver as a "liberal" Democrat supportive of the likes of Hillary Clinton, Barack Obama, Nancy Pelsoi, Chuck Schumer and current DNC chair Tom Perez. Oliver is considered a loyal foot soldier for the Democrats who uses his mastery over humor to take down the Trumpeteers, et. al.

Most of those who watch, follow and adore Oliver are good and solid Democrats, many of whom consider their own viewpoints rather progressive. So, to them, watching John Oliver is like a breath of fresh air.

But we're talking oil here, folks. We're also talking about banking! We're fundamentally talking about real Venezuelan socialism vs. America's unfettered brand of capitalism, i.e., John Oliver's yearly salaries, bonuses and special perks.

My purpose in writing here is not to get into the specifics of Venezuela. Rather my purpose is to show you how a presumably perceived good Democrat can actually be a bad one. A Republican, really. John Oliver, case in point!

The sad part is that since the Clintons took over the Democratic Party the Democrats have become Republicans, with the principles of labor and peace from George McGovern completely abandoned.

The late Gore Vidal described it best: America has two political parties with one right wing.

If the 2016 presidential election didn't prove much of this for you, perhaps a solid review of the debunking critique of John Oliver’s obvious attempt to politically indoctrinate supposedly solid Democrats might help you realize Gore Vidal’s statement is right on the mark.

Venezuela -- like Iraq, Libya and Syria -- abandoned the US petro dollar. This is significant because Venezuela holds the largest oil reserves in the world and has nationalized its oil industry thus depriving the Dick Cheney-like types on the world markets.

Perhaps the only thing that so far has saved Venezuela from a full scale US invasion has been the US being bogged down predominately killing in the Middle East via its use of several proxy army and rebel units coupled with large scale funding support from Saudi Arabia and Gulf Emirate nations.

But the US, via its drug war commando specialists in Colombia and elsewhere, also have proxy soldiers ready and nearby Venezuela. The day may well come, especially if Trump determines he needs become a "war president" for his re-election -- an act the US oligarchy will certainly support (also the oligarchy-supporting Democrats behind the scenes).

It's time for many of you to realize Gore Vidal was and is correct. Consider also how a once-widely respected progressive writer like David Corn, with a considerably larger salary these days, now describes the Russian "government" as the Russian "regime." Corn never used to write like that! What happened to once proud progressives Howard Dean, Barney Frank and others?

Conclusion? The Democrats ain't what they're supposed to be! Clinton still controls the DNC and all of the large state Democratic committees ... as well as the money Democrats get. This is part of why Venezuela -- as proven by John Oliver -- like Honduras, will ultimately get a raw deal!
